What are the advantages of having a redundant network?

If you look at redundant networks in nature, like the network of the veins within a leaf you may realize that redundancy creates resilience.

Often leaves are subjected to parasites or physical damage. If a vital vein is struck in a network without redundancy it would mean all tissues or nodes which it previously fed into would be effectively annihilated from the network (death). A redundant network overcomes this problem by spreading out the risk.

From a Computational standpoint this would be the same problem. Often critical layers of a network if left without connectivity would create critical failures for parts of the network which may be dependent on its activity. Such is the nature of hierarchy.

What is Mac address of the wireless adapter?

MAC addresses are a kind of serial number. They are supposed to be unique worldwide; that is, two different network equipments, even of the same kind, will have different MAC addresses. They are used for communication, to identify the individual pieces of equipment.

How do wireless printers work?

A wireless print server is a device which will enable you to share your USB or Parallel port printer on a wireless or wired network.
The print server can be configured to connect to an existing wireless network and can then be connected to the printer via the USB or Parallel port, once this has been done the printer should be available for use on any computer on the network.

Can you use an 802.11n router with an 802.11g wireless card?

Yes. An 802.11n card should be backwards compatible with 802.11g/b. If you have a router that supports 802.11g, then the 802.11 card will work. But you are not gaining anything by using the n card with a g AP. The card will simply function as a 802.11g card.

How do you get wired and wireless on ubuntu 9.10?

For wireless cards that do not work out of the box, you will need to identify the wireless chipset used. You can do this by running "lspci" in a terminal, and looking for names such as "Broadcom, Realtek, Atmel, etc... Afterwards, you can install a third-party module by connecting via Ethernet and running

sudo apt-get install [package name]

The package you will want to install depends on the chipset.

Atmel - atmel-firmware

Broadcom - bcm43xx-fwcutter
